    Pregnant mothers? occupational factors linked to pregnancy complications
    Author(s): Rehab Flieh Hassan* and Muna Abdulwahab Khaleel

    Woman's occupation can have a profound impact on her pregnancy and the health of her developing fetus. It is crucial to address the multifaceted challenges associated with occupational exposures during pregnancy, including physical demands, hazardous substances, psychosocial stressors, and ergonomic factors. This work aims to investigates the relationship between occupational factors with some certain related characteristics of pregnant women and their association with pregnancy complications in Al-Hilla City, Iraq. Utilizing a quantitative, cross-sectional design, data were collected from 250 pregnant women attending two governmental hospitals between December 2023 and June 2024.
